Kansan among 31 Marines who died in crash

? A former Council Grove High School student was among the 31 killed when a Marine helicopter crashed last month in Iraq.

Lance Cpl. Tony Hernandez, who was rejected for being overweight the first time he tried to join the Marines, died Jan. 26. He was 22.

Hernandez was one of 30 Marines who died when their helicopter crashed in bad weather while they were being flown to provide security for the recent Iraqi national elections. A Navy corpsman also was killed in the crash.

Hernandez’s funeral was Thursday in New Braunfels, Texas.

Hernandez attended Council Grove High School through his junior year, before transferring to Smithson Valley (Texas) High School in 2000.

“Tony was a lot of fun,” said Joe Buchanan, an English teacher and baseball coach at Council Grove High School. “He had a good sense of humor. He wasn’t a very good athlete, but he always had a good time, he always enjoyed himself. He was good to have around.”

After his rejection in 2001, Hernandez began a program of diet and exercise and was admitted to the Marine Corps in 2002.

While on leave, he married his wife, Jacquie. Their first anniversary would have been Monday.
